[发明专利]用于浮点加法器的舍入预测方法有效
申请号: | 201310379718.1 | 申请日: | 2013-08-27 |
公开(公告)号: | CN103455305B | 公开(公告)日: | 2016-11-30 |
发明(设计)人: | 邵志标;李凌浩 | 申请(专利权)人: | 西安交通大学 |
主分类号: | G06F7/57 | 分类号: | G06F7/57 |
代理公司: | 西安通大专利代理有限责任公司 61200 | 代理人: | 汪人和 |
地址: | 710049 ***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 浮点 加法器 预测 方法 | ||
1.用于浮点加法器的舍入预测方法,其特征在于:舍入预测单元同加法器的尾数加法器并行工作,产生包含舍入进位信息的规格化移位控制信号和尾数调整控制信号,利用规格化移位控制信号对尾数和与指数进行调整,得到包含舍入进位信息的规格化结果,利用尾数调整控制信号对移位后的尾数进行调整,得到加法器的最终结果。
2.如权利要求1所述的用于浮点加法器的舍入预测方法,其特征在于:所述预测方法包括:(1)求取尾数高位进位;(2)根据尾数高位进位进行舍入进位预测;(3)根据步骤(1)和步骤(2)的结果产生和构造包含舍入进位信息的规格化移位控制信号和尾数调整控制信号。
3.如权利要求2所述的用于浮点加法器的舍入预测方法,其特征在于:尾数高位进位采用并行与递推算法相结合的方法求取,具体为:
利用并行算法求得c[M-1]和c[M-4],其余尾数高位进位由c[M-1]和c[M-4]递推得到,这里已知,z[0]=0,则:
c[M]=g[0]?1:c[M-1]
类似的,c[M-2],c[M-3],由c[M-4]递推得到,则可计算c[M-2],c[M-3]分别为:
c[M-3]=g[3]?1:(c[M-4]&&t[3])
c[M-2]=c_[M-2]?1:(c[M-4]&&t[3]&&t[4])
其中c_[M-2]为加速c[M-2]所构造的中间结果。
4.如权利要求2所述的用于浮点加法器的舍入预测方法,其特征在于:所述步骤(2)舍入进位预测的方法为:(2.1)首先根据尾数高位进位判断结果符号sgn;(2.2)确定舍入进位选择信号,使之分别对应结果为正和结果为负的情形;(2.3)根据结果符号sgn以及舍入进位选择信号从舍入进位值中选出舍入进位序列cr[0:1],同理,根据结果符号sgn以及舍入进位选择信号选择尾数高位进位cx;(2.4)根据步骤(2.3)选择的尾数高位进位cx的值判断是否考虑由舍入带来的低位进位cfr对结果的影响;(2.5)判断舍入进位是否可以传递到高位以影响结果。
5.如权利要求4所述的用于浮点加法器的舍入预测方法,其特征在于:步骤(2.1)中,根据式sgn=sgn_1?~c[M]:a[N]判断结果符号sgn,其中,sgn_1标记两个操作数是否异号,a[N]为指数较大操作数符号位。
6.如权利要求4所述的用于浮点加法器的舍入预测方法,其特征在于:步骤(2.2)中,确定舍入进位选择信号的方法为:
对同号的两个操作数,可直接求出舍入位选择信号c_slctp[0]和c_slctn[0],使之分别对应结果为正和结果为负的情形:
c_slctp[0]=sgn_1nor(~rmc[1])
c_slctn[0]=sgn_1nor(~rmc[0])
当两个操作数异号时,分别求得舍入位选择信号c_slctp[1:3]和c_slctn[1:3]:
其中fzero为前导0预测字段,fone为前导1预测字段;e_p和e_n分别为对应结果为正和结果为负时候的舍入使能信号,则c_s=sgn?c_slctn:c_slctp,确定舍入位选择信号c_s[0:3]。
7.如权利要求4所述的用于浮点加法器的舍入预测方法,其特征在于:由舍入带来的低位进位:cfr=cx?cr[0]:cr[1],其中:
cx=sgn?((c[M-1]&&c_slctn[0])||(c[M-2]&&c_slctn[1])
||(c[M-3]&&c_slctn[2])||(c[M-4]&&c_slctn[3]))。
:((c[M]&&c_slctp[0])||(c[M-1]&&c_slctp[1])
||(c[M-2]&&c_slctp[2])||(c[M-3]&&c_slctp[3]))
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西安交通大学,未经西安交通大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201310379718.1/1.html,转载请声明来源钻瓜专利网。
- 上一篇:动能液压回收装置
- 下一篇:一种电子放大镜的实现方法及用户终端